Saw this ad headline running on a major publisher inside @taboola This Taboola headline is doing 4 things at once and most copywriters only see 2 of them: "Why Some People Can Set Six Alarms And Not Hear A Single One" 1️⃣ It's a curiosity gap — you can't NOT want to know the answer 2️⃣ It's identity-safe — "some people" = not YOU, so no shame trigger, no scroll-past 3️⃣ It's hyper-relatable to the 55+ desktop reader at 9am who just did exactly this 4️⃣ It implies a medical/biological reason — which primes the reader for a supplement or sleep product CTA without ever saying "buy anything" The word "Why" is doing the heaviest lifting. It's not "How To Sleep Better." It's not "Fix Your Sleep." It creates a knowledge gap the brain physically needs to close. That's why it gets the click. The best native headlines don't sell. They make not clicking feel uncomfortable.

This 15-second ad has 450+ duplicates active on Facebook right now… Yes. 15 seconds. Memory loss VSL offer. The hook? “Watch what eggs do to your brain…” That’s it. No crazy editing. No cinematic visuals. No “brand storytelling”. Just pure curiosity. Sometimes you guys overcomplicate direct response ads. If your VSL converts… Your only job is getting as many eyeballs into the funnel as possible. That’s why these guys test EVERYTHING: → Clickbaity videos → Native statics → AI avatars → Weird hooks The ad doesn’t need to sell the product. The VSL does. The ad sells the click. That’s it. 450+ duplicates. I think they understand that pretty well.

If you're a copywriter, study lawyers in your free time. Lawyer's don't hope for you to believe them. They build cases so strong that they remove logical objections completely. That's how copywriting should be. You don't want to hope that your copy converts. You want your copy to be so good that it removes objections completely when people see it. Search "best closing arguments trial" on YouTube. Then go back to your copy and ask What objections am I leaving unanswered? Because every unanswered objection your copy has is a lost sale.
